The role:

The Solution Architecture function is a key part of the architecture team at St. James’s Place.

The role holder will play a key part in shaping the vision of our Solution Architecture Practice, ensuring that we capitalise on our potential and deliver high quality systems and integrations which align to our corporate objectives, ensuring we deliver the right outcomes for our partners.

As a Senior Solution Architect, you will aid in the socialisation of our capability to senior collaborators and Architecture/Design boards, influencing the decision-making processes by using your own in-depth knowledge of the internal & external marketplace, whilst making use of external sources and networks.

What you'll be doing:

  • Own and set new technology standards & best practices within the architecture and design community, working closely with subject matter experts internally and external to the organisation to deliver high impacting strategic technology roadmaps.
  • Drive the overall Architectural view of the Application
  • Proactively communicate and collaborate with external and internal stakeholders, have a clear understanding of strategic business requirements as well as deliver the following artefacts as needed: Conceptual, logical and physical designs, Interface designs, taking account of functional and non-functional requirements
  • Using your experience & in-depth knowledge, lead the solution architecture aspects of high-profile Programmes of work, leading by example to ensure the needs of our stakeholders
  • Understand business drivers and business capabilities (future and current state), and determine corresponding system designs and change requirements to drive the organisation’s targeted business outcomes
  • Initiate working groups to develop new thought processes and innovate ideas aligning to the corporate objectives. Promoting a culture of idea sharing and innovation to enhance the divisions capabilities.
  • Work closely with other domains of architecture and design (Enterprise, Service Design and Central Data Office) to design architecture for a single project or initiative
  • Understand technology trends and the practical application of existing, new, and emerging technologies to enable new and evolving business and operating models.
  • Develop capability roadmaps for the division to ensure we have the right technologies and processes in place to achieve the divisions corporate objectives and align to the wider divisions’ strategic plans.

Who we're looking for:

An excellent understanding of the project lifecycle, the ability to explain complex technical information in to simple language, exceptional interpersonal skills with confidence to challenge, methodical and collaborative outlook to tasks and projects.

Essential Criteria

  • Technical expertise in cloud platforms, software architecture, and database management
  • Demonstrable experience in application integration approaches, lifecycle management, and translating business requirements into technical solutions
  • Expert understanding of architectural frameworks such as TOGAF, Zachman or ArchiMate or equivalent
  • Significant experience in designing and implementing solutions from high level requirements to target state architecture and transition.
